UFC Fight Night: Wonderboy vs Darren Till to be Broadcast by BBC

The upcoming UFC welterweight bout between #1 ranked contender Stephen ‘Wonderboy’ Thompson and Darren Till is to be broadcast by the BBC for the first time when the pair take to the octagon in Liverpool on May 27th.

The BBC will be covering the fight on Radio 5 Live with commentary from Malcom Martin and former UFC fighter Brad Pickett and will be hosted by OJ Borg and Nick Peet. This will mark the first time that the BBC will broadcast any UFC event, however it is unsure if this will be a regular occurrence – due to the kickoff time for most events being in the early hours in the UK.

The fight between Wonderboy and Till has the potential to turn what is already a hectic welterweight division on it’s head. With Tyron Woodley still working his way back from a shoulder injury and an interim title fight slated to take place between former lightweight champion Rafael Dos Anjos and the outspoken American fighter Colby Covington, Till coming out on top could launch all of the UFC’s current plans for the division up in the air.

Ben Gallop, head of BBC radio and digital sport, said: “Broadcasting a UFC event live on BBC 5 live sports extra is a landmark moment for us.

“The growing popularity of UFC in the UK, particularly amongst younger audiences, makes it the ideal sport for us to broadcast live, offering comprehensive coverage to our millions of listeners.

“Our coverage on BBC 5 live sports extra and the BBC Sport website will ensure fans won’t miss a moment of the action in Liverpool.”

While the hype for this upcoming fight night card is mostly (and with good reason) focussed around the main event, the co-main event also features an important battle in the middleweight division – with #9 ranked fighter Neil Magny taking on unranked Craig White. Magny comes into this fight looking to put together his first win streak since 2016, after failing to secure back to back wins in his last four visits to the octagon.

The fight will still be broadcast on BT Sport 2 with coverage starting at 6pm. The full fight card for UFC Fight Night: Thompson vs Till is:

UFC Main card:

  • Welterweight – Steven Thompson vs Darren Till
  • Welterweight – Neil Magny vs Craig White
  • Featherweight – Arnold Allen vs Mads Burnell
  • Featherweight: Jason Knight vs Makwan Amirkhani
  • Bantamweight: Davey Grant vs Manny Bermudez
  • Middleweight: Eric Spicely vs Darren Stewart

Prelims:

  • Welterweight: Claudio Silva vs Nordine Taleb
  • Middleweight: Dan Kelly vs Tom Breese
  • Welterweight: Brad Scott vs Carlo Pedersoli Jr.
  • Women’s Flyweight: Gillian Robertson vs Molly McCann
  • Middleweight (UFC Fight Pass): Elias Theodorou vs Trevor Smith
  • Women’s Bantamweight (UFC Fight Pass): Gina Mazany vs Lina Lansberg
